托布轮滑机构焊接成形工艺优化

Welding process optimization for fabric roller parts

摘要 针对托布轮滑机构焊接变形问题,分析焊接变形缺陷成因;根据托布轮滑机构装配尺寸精度要求,基于工业机器人自动焊接设备,采用"一体式"焊接夹具装夹,优化焊接成形工艺,进行托布轮滑机构焊接制作。经实践验证,"一体式"焊接夹具结构稳定可靠,焊接成形工艺合理,有效解决焊接变形问题,满足托布轮滑机构安装工艺要求,具有一定实用价值。 The causes of the deformation defects were analyzed aiming at the deformation problem for welding of fabric roller parts.Considering the high assembly accuracy of fabric roller parts,it was fabricated with adopting an "integrated"welding fixture and optimizing welding process,based on industrial robot automatic welding equipment.It was proved by practice that the new "integrated"welding fixture structure is stable and reliable,and the weld forming process is reasonable,which leads to good effect and less deformation and can meet the manufacturing requirement for fabric roller parts.It can give some reference for the welding fixture design of similar products.
